Excerpt from The Metallurgy of Silver, Gold, and Mercury in the United States, Vol. 2 of 2: Gold and Mercury The publication of this volume has been retarded by circumstances entirely beyond my control, but it is hoped that the two volumes will present a succinct and clear statement of the metallurgy of silver, gold, and mercury in the United States in such detail as it is possible for so rapidly growing and changing a science to be presented in volumes of this kind. The treatment of silver bearing lead ores requires a separate volume. About the Publisher Forgotten Books publishes hundreds of thousands of rare and classic books.
